3
respostas

NÃO ENCONTRA O PARENTESES DA DIREITA - ORA 00907

CREATE TABLE TB_VENDEDORES ( MATRICULA INT(5), NOME VARCHAR(100), PERCENTUAL_COMISSÃO FLOAT )

3 respostas

Olá Miguel, tudo bem?

Quando é utilizado o tipo INT, não se especifica tamanho do campo, então você poderia executar a sua query da seguinte forma:

CREATE TABLE TB_VENDEDORES ( MATRICULA INT, NOME VARCHAR(100), PERCENTUAL_COMISSÃO FLOAT )

Caso você queira especificar tamanho do campo, você poderia utilizar o tipo NVARCHA2, como o instrutor utiliza no curso.

Espero ter ajudado e bons estudos!

Boa noite,

Também tive esse problema. Obrigado pela ajuda.

Quais são os parâmetros do tipo DATE?

Olá Ramon, tudo bem?

Ao utilizar o tipo DATE também não é especificado parâmetros:

CREATE TABLE  tb_teste (
 id INT, 
nome VARCHAR(100),
idade DATE);

Espero ter ajudado e bons estudos!